Summary

Riot Games has laid off 30 employees from its 2XKO team as part of its efforts to pursue a more sustainable operational path. The layoffs occurred in Los Angeles, California, and reflect the company's ongoing adjustments to its workforce. This decision comes as Riot Games aims to streamline its operations and focus on long-term sustainability. The company has not specified any future layoffs but emphasizes its commitment to adapting to market conditions. The layoffs are part of a broader trend in the gaming industry as companies reassess their workforce needs.

LayoffTalk has tracked 20 layoff events at Riot Games since October 2023, including 418 jobs documented in official WARN filings, with 17 additional events known from news reporting.
